The CY26501PVC is a programmable clock generator from Cypress Semiconductor Corp. It is designed to provide precise timing signals for a variety of applications. It offers flexibility in generating multiple clock frequencies from a single crystal or reference clock, making it suitable for complex systems requiring various clock domains.

Additional Details
The CY26501PVC supports various output clock formats, including LVCMOS, LVPECL, and LVDS. It typically operates from a 3.3V or 2.5V power supply. Its programmable nature allows for in-system configuration, enabling dynamic clock frequency adjustments to optimize performance and power consumption. The exact specifications can vary based on the specific revision; refer to the official Cypress Semiconductor datasheet for detailed information.
